Docker进行测试的最大优势之一是,您不需要在要运行这些测试的所有机器上都安装测试中所需的代码依赖项。 这对于外部服务(例如数据库服务器,邮件服务,JMS队列等)确实很有帮助。此方法的一大优势是测试将使用生产中使用的相同版本。 Docker的持久性测试,这是一个非常好的遵循方法。 但是通常这种方法有一些缺点。 第一个是,显然,您需要在所有需要运行测试的机器上安装Docker ,这不是一个大问
转载 2023-11-08 22:13:44
88阅读
UDP 概述用户数据报协议 UDP 只在 IP 的数据报服务之上增加了很少一点的功能,这就是复用和分用的功能以及查错检测的功能UDP 的主要特点UDP 是无连接的,即发送数据之前不需要建立连接(发送数据结束时也没有连接可释放),减少了开销和发送数据之前的时延UDP 使用尽最大努力交付,即不保证可靠交付,主机不需要维持复杂的连接状态表UDP 是面向报文的,发送方的 UDP 对应用程序交
# 测试 Docker UDP 端口是否打开的完整指南 在现代软件开发中,Docker 已经成为了一个流行的容器化解决方案。测试 Docker 容器的 UDP 端口是否开放对确保应用正常运行至关重要。在这篇文章中,我们将深入探讨如何测试 Docker UDP 端口是否打开。首先,我们会展示整个流程,并详细解释每一个步骤。 ## 流程概述 我们将整个测试过程分为以下几个步骤: | 步骤
原创 2024-08-28 08:02:32
174阅读
一面1、自我介绍2、TCP UDP的区别 (1) TCP面向连接(如打电话要先拨号建立连接);UDP是无连接的,即发送数据之前不需要建立连接 (2) TCP提供可靠的服务、也就是说,通过TCP连接传输的数据是无差错、不丢失、不重复且按序到达;UDP尽最大努力交付,即不保证可靠交付 (3) TCP的逻辑通信信息是全双工的可靠信息;UDP则是不可靠信息 (4) 每一条TCP连接只能是点对点的;UDP
docker的安装见官方文档 我使用的系统为Ubuntu16.04Ubuntu系统安装docker文档地址:https://docs.docker.com/engine/installation/linux/ubuntulinux/Ubuntu的版本必须和文档中提到的要一致---------------------------------------------------------------
转载 2023-06-20 21:28:32
255阅读
上一篇我们主要讲了一些简单的docker网络,包括自定义网络,但都是限制于一台主机,这节我们主要来学习下容器访问不同主机上的容器和访问容器外的通信网络。一、容器访问外部通信 我们的主机和默认的网桥容器都是可以访问外部网络,通过抓包可以看出来是docker0也是通过本机的ens33网络把流量转发到外网的 (1)、容器busybox发出ping包:172.1
容器跨主机网络-UDP解析1. 容器跨主机网络的问题上一节描述了同一宿主机下容器访问宿主机或其他容器的方式,默认docker配置下,不同宿主机之间的容器网络没有任何关联,所以无法做到跨主通信。要解决跨主通信的问题,就需要在已有的主机网络通过软件再构建一个可以把所有容器连通起来的虚拟网络,这个技术就是我们常聊到的overlay network。容器跨主机的访问常用的主流方法有UDP、VXLAN、ho
转载 2023-10-06 20:27:50
313阅读
Linux是一款备受欢迎的操作系统,而红帽(Red Hat)则是一家提供企业级Linux解决方案的知名公司。在Linux系统中,网络通信是一个非常重要的功能,而UDP协议作为一种无连接的传输协议,具有传输速度快、效率高等优点,被广泛应用于各种网络通信场景中。在Linux系统中进行UDP测试,是一项非常重要的工作,也是保证网络通信稳定性与性能的关键之一。 在Linux系统中进行UDP测试,通常需要
原创 2024-03-18 11:13:57
252阅读
  在Linux系统中,测试端口通不通是非常常见的情况之一,比如我们进行网络调试的时候就需要测试验证对应的端口是否正常,那么Linux中测试端口通不通的方法是什么?以下是详细内容介绍。  1、使用telnet命令  telnet命令是一个网络工具,可以用于测试远程主机的端口是否开放。它通过尝试与指定的主机和端口建立TCP连接来测试端口。  以下是使用telnet命令测试端口的步骤:  telnet
菩提本无根,明镜亦非台基于UDP协议的套接字通信:1.UDP是无连接的,先启动那一端都不会报错。UDP服务端:ss = socket() #创建一个服务器的套接字 ss.bind() #绑定服务器套接字 inf_loop: #服务器无限循环 cs = ss.recvfrom()/ss.sendto() # 对话(接收与发送) ss.close()
导语:大牛们常常说阅读源码是很低效的学习方法。但对我辈初学者而言,阅读源码却是掌握编程思想、编码规范的好途径。简而言之,读源码不是万能的,不读源码是万万不能的。SocketServer是标准库中一个很具有代表性的库。它基于socket提供一套快速建立socket服务器的框架,并可以通过Mix-in的技巧让单线程服务器进化为多线程或多进程服务器。Socketserver.py里面的类很多,下面一个一
转载 2023-09-30 10:45:08
74阅读
# Docker实现UDP的流程 本文将介绍如何使用Docker实现UDP通信的步骤,帮助刚入行的小白理解并实现该功能。下面是整个过程的流程图: ```mermaid gantt title Docker实现UDP通信流程 section 准备工作 创建Docker镜像 :a1, 2022-01-01, 2d 创建Docker容器
原创 2023-08-17 08:36:32
158阅读
文章目录**1、docker架构****2、docker常用命令总结****3、容器迁器****4、小知识:** 1、docker架构Docker 使用客户端-服务器 (C/S) 架构模式,使用远程API来管理和创建Docker容器。Docker 容器通过 Docker 镜像来创建。容器与镜像的关系类似于面向对象编程中的对象与类。Docker 面向对象容器 对象镜像 类2、docker常用命令总
转载 2023-07-10 15:45:25
205阅读
docker容器中部署网络程序进行通信实验语言:python1.实验目的:这次试验是在docker容器中部署网络程序,初定为写一个简单的web服务器并部署到docker上,然后让其他主机访问。开发语言使用python语言。2.实验过程:(1)搭建python开发环境注意,实验是要在docker容器中进行的,所以是在docker容器内安装环境的。首先新打开一个ubuntu容器,并进入然后输入以下命
转载 2023-09-23 15:54:25
196阅读
记录docker部署项目操作1.docker运行启动sudo systemctl start docker验证docker正常sudo docker run hello-world 2.开放端口以上结果表示正常运行,不行就得自己配置了ufw disable //关闭防火墙 ufw enable //开启防火墙 ufw status //查看状态开放端口ufw allow 80xx如果这
转载 2024-05-21 05:57:58
50阅读
Linux操作系统是一种广泛使用的开源操作系统,其内核是由Linus Torvalds开发。在Linux操作系统中,有一个非常重要的网络协议——UDP协议(User Datagram Protocol),它是一种无连接的传输层协议,与TCP协议相比,UDP协议传输速度更快,但传输可靠性较低。 在Linux系统中,测试UDP协议的功能和性能非常重要,其中使用到的工具之一就是红帽(Red Hat)的
原创 2024-02-27 12:18:26
184阅读
# Python UDP 测试:网络编程基础介绍 Python是一种非常流行的编程语言,广泛用于网络编程、数据分析和人工智能等各种应用。在网络编程方面,UDP(用户数据报协议)是一个重要的传输协议,由于其简单性和低延迟特性,常用于实时应用,如视频流和在线游戏。本文将介绍如何使用Python进行UDP测试,并提供相关代码示例。 ## UDP 简介 UDP即用户数据报协议(User Datagr
原创 10月前
53阅读
这篇文章主要为大家详细介绍了Python使用SocketServer框架编写程序的简单示例,具有一定的参考价值,可以用来参考一下。对python这个高级语言感兴趣的小伙伴,下面一起跟随512笔记的小编两巴掌来看看吧!1.前言:虽说用Python编写简单的网络程序很方便,但复杂一点的网络程序还是用现成的框架比较好。这样就可以专心事务逻辑,而不是套接字的各种细节。SocketServer模块简化了编写
jemter本身不支持udp测试,需要下载安装第三方插件,或者下载一个插件管理器(下面那个蝴蝶一样的图标),里面有各种插件可以供你下载 下载链接:https://jmeter-plugins.org/install/Install/ 按照提示进行操作 重启之后进入刚刚那个插件选择如下 添加线程组,然
原创 2021-08-04 13:38:49
881阅读
## UDP测试 Android 作为一名经验丰富的开发者,我将向你介绍如何在 Android 上进行 UDP 测试UDP 是一种无连接的传输协议,适用于实时应用和流媒体传输。本文将指导你完成 UDP 测试的步骤,并提供相应的代码示例。 ### 流程图 下面是 UDP 测试的整体流程图,以便更好地理解每个步骤的关联和顺序。 ```mermaid stateDiagram [*]
原创 2023-11-12 04:03:49
221阅读
  • 1
  • 2
  • 3
  • 4
  • 5